手工编程类汽车怎么做的

时间:2025-03-04 18:22:32 明星趣事

制作手工编程类汽车涉及多个步骤和技能,以下是一个基本的指南:

硬件知识

了解电子元器件、传感器、电机驱动等硬件组成部分的原理和工作方式。

学会使用电子工具进行焊接、接线和组装。

编程语言

学习至少一种编程语言,例如C、Python等,以便通过编写程序控制小车的运动和功能。

电路设计与控制

学会设计电路板,包括电源管理、电机驱动、传感器接口等。

掌握控制电机的相关知识,如PWM调速、编码器反馈等。

机械结构设计

学习机械结构的基本原理,包括齿轮传动、轮子与电机的连接方式等。

了解如何设计和制作适合自己小车的机械结构。

通信技术

学习无线通信技术,如蓝牙、Wi-Fi、红外线等,以便实现与小车的无线通信和控制。

算法与控制

学习基本的算法和控制理论,包括路径规划、避障算法等,以便实现小车的自主导航和避障功能。

实践经验

通过实践和项目实施,积累经验并不断改进和优化自己的编程小车。

设计

确定汽车的外观形状和尺寸,以及内部结构和机械部件的布局。

可以使用CAD软件进行设计,并根据设计图纸制作所需的零件。

材料选择

选择适当的材料,如塑料、金属和木材,考虑到重量、强度和耐用性等因素。

组装

根据设计图纸,将所需的零件按照顺序组装起来,确保结构稳固。

程序编写

使用编程语言编写程序,控制汽车的行驶、转向和停止等动作。

根据小汽车的硬件设备和传感器进行调试和优化,以实现预期的功能。

调试与优化

在搭建和编程完成后,进行调试和优化,确保小车能够正常运行并实现预期功能。

通过以上步骤,你可以逐步完成一个手工编程类汽车的制作。建议从简单的项目开始,逐步积累经验和技能,以便能够制作出更加复杂和功能丰富的作品。